wrist pain with wrist push ups

I really want to improve my wrist strength and so I've set my sights on Coach Sommers wrist series. The problem is the wrist push ups hurt, quite a bit actually. Has anyone else experienced pain with wrist push ups, and if you did, did you find a solution?

As soon as I realised how weak my wrists were, I started doing wrist pushups. This was 3-4 weeks ago. At first, I couldn't event support my weigth in the pushup position (yes, with knees), so I followed coach sommer's tip and piked a little during the pushups. It helps a lot in the begining as it puts some of your weigth on the legs instead of the wrists. Now I'm able to do 5 sets of 10 rep of wrist pushups with knees, with a good execution. Soon I hope to be able to perform them wihtout the knees.

Just keep trying hard, and you will improve! Take care to not get hurt!

One variation i've been trying with some success is to start at a wall and move down to a chair etc. I'm not sure its Coach approved but i find it more satisfying as i can do the full movement 'correctly and by finding the just right height to work from get more work from my wrists than just being on the knees.
